Miami Beach is a barrier-island city between the Atlantic and Biscayne Bay, and it is large and varied enough that "Miami Beach" describes a market rather than a neighborhood. Buying well here means choosing a district first.
South Beach holds the Art Deco Historic District and the densest concentration of restaurants, hotels and nightlife, with housing running from restored Deco apartment buildings to new oceanfront towers. Mid-Beach, along the Collins corridor, mixes large oceanfront condominium buildings with quieter residential streets. North Beach is lower-rise and more residential in character.
Separately from the oceanfront, the man-made islands in the bay (among them the Venetian Islands, Sunset Islands, La Gorce and the Star, Palm and Hibiscus group) hold the city's single-family estate inventory, much of it waterfront with private dockage and some of it guarded. These are a different market from the beachfront towers, and they are where most of the city's large houses trade.
"Miami Beach" covers several distinct markets, and choosing the district is the decision that matters most. Ask about the district, not the city
A record in Miami Beach can mean South of Fifth or it can mean North Beach. Ask which, because they are different markets.
Ask whether the property is historically designated
Much of South Beach sits in the Art Deco Historic District, where exterior changes go through review. That governs what you can do after you own it.
Ask island versus oceanfront
A gated bay island and an oceanfront tower attract different buyers and behave differently on resale. Both are called Miami Beach.
Ask about the rental rules
Short-term rental rights vary sharply between districts and between buildings. If income is part of your plan, confirm it in writing before you offer.

Questions
Miami Beach buyer questions
Which part of Miami Beach should I look in?
It depends on what you want. South Beach for the Art Deco district and walkable nightlife, Mid-Beach for large oceanfront buildings on the Collins corridor, North Beach for a lower-rise residential feel, and the bay islands for single-family estates with dockage.
Are there single-family homes in Miami Beach?
Yes, principally on the man-made islands in Biscayne Bay (the Venetian and Sunset Islands, La Gorce, and the Star, Palm and Hibiscus group), along with residential streets in North Beach. Much of that inventory is waterfront with private dockage.
What is the Art Deco Historic District?
A protected district in South Beach containing one of the largest concentrations of 1930s Art Deco architecture anywhere. Buildings within it are subject to preservation rules, which affects what can be altered on a given property.
Is Miami Beach the same as the City of Miami?
No. Miami Beach is a separate city on the barrier island; the City of Miami is on the mainland across Biscayne Bay. They have different governments, tax rolls and building codes.
